Etymology

edit

Inherited from Ashokan Prakrit *𑀭𑁄𑀓𑁆𑀓 (*rokka) + Middle Indo-Aryan -𑀟- (-ḍa-),[1] from Sanskrit रोक (roka, buying with ready money). Compare Punjabi ਰੋਕੜ (rokaṛ) / روکَڑ (rokaṛ), Sindhi روڪَڙِ / रोकड़ि, Gujarati રોકડ (rokaḍ), Marathi रोकड (rokaḍ), Telugu రొక్కము (rokkamu), Kannada ರೊಕ್ಕ (rokka), Tamil ரொக்கம் (rokkam), Malayalam റൊക്കം (ṟokkaṁ).

Noun

edit

रोकड़ (rokaṛf (Urdu spelling روکَڑ)

  1. ready money, hard cash
    Synonym: नक़द (naqad)
  2. gold, jewels, valuables, stock, etc. (as convertible into hard cash)
